phast binary package in Ubuntu Noble armhf

 PHAST is a software package for comparative and evolutionary genomics.
 It consists of about half a dozen major programs, plus more than a dozen
 utilities for manipulating sequence alignments, phylogenetic trees, and
 genomic annotations. For the most part, PHAST focuses on two kinds of
 applications: the identification of novel functional elements, including
 protein-coding exons and evolutionarily conserved sequences; and
 statistical phylogenetic modeling, including estimation of model
 parameters, detection of signatures of selection, and reconstruction of
 ancestral sequences.
 .
 PHAST does not support phylogeny reconstruction or sequence alignment,
 and it is designed for use with DNA sequences only (see Comparison).
